Subject: [PATCH 8/8] ath11k: Add bdf-addr in hw_params
Date: Tue, 9 Jun 2020 10:33:13 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1591678993-11016-9-git-send-email-akolli@codeaurora.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1591678993-11016-1-git-send-email-akolli@codeaurora.org>
bdf-addr is different for IPQ8074 and IPQ6018
Signed-off-by: Anilkumar Kolli <akolli@codeaurora.org>
---
dr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/core.c | 2 ++
dr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/hw.h | 1 +
dr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.c | 6 +++---
dr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.h | 1 -
4 files changed, 6 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/core.c b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/core.c
index 79ee97e91159..7d528677e3a3 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/core.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/core.c
@@ -27,6 +27,7 @@ static const struct ath11k_hw_params ath11k_hw_params_list[] = {
.cal_size = IPQ8074_MAX_CAL_DATA_SZ,
},
.max_radios = 3,
+ .bdf_addr = 0x4B0C0000,
.hw_ops = &ipq8074_ops,
},
{
@@ -38,6 +39,7 @@ static const struct ath11k_hw_params ath11k_hw_params_list[] = {
.cal_size = IPQ6018_MAX_CAL_DATA_SZ,
},
.max_radios = 2,
+ .bdf_addr = 0x4ABC0000,
.hw_ops = &ipq6018_ops,
},
};
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/hw.h b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/hw.h
index 5b5cd56c1aea..6d372eeb869c 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/hw.h
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/hw.h
@@ -115,6 +115,7 @@ struct ath11k_hw_ops {
struct ath11k_hw_params {
const char *name;
+ u32 bdf_addr;
u16 dev_id;
u8 max_radios;
struct {
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.c b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.c
index c00a99ad8dbc..e4198d3b0bae 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.c
@@ -1681,8 +1681,8 @@ static int ath11k_qmi_alloc_target_mem_chunk(struct ath11k_base *ab)
for (i = 0, idx = 0; i < ab->qmi.mem_seg_count; i++) {
switch (ab->qmi.target_mem[i].type) {
case BDF_MEM_REGION_TYPE:
- 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].paddr = ATH11K_QMI_BDF_ADDRESS;
- 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].vaddr = ATH11K_QMI_BDF_ADDRESS;
+ 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].paddr = ab->hw_params.bdf_addr;
+ 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].vaddr = ab->hw_params.bdf_addr;
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].size = ab->qmi.target_mem[i].size;
ab->qmi.target_mem[idx].type = ab->qmi.target_mem[i].type;
idx++;
@@ -1854,7 +1854,7 @@ static int ath11k_qmi_load_bdf(struct ath11k_base *ab)
return -ENOMEM;
memset(&resp, 0, sizeof(resp));
- bdf_addr = ioremap(ATH11K_QMI_BDF_ADDRESS, ATH11K_QMI_BDF_MAX_SIZE);
+ bdf_addr = ioremap(ab->hw_params.bdf_addr, ATH11K_QMI_BDF_MAX_SIZE);
if (!bdf_addr) {
ath11k_warn(ab, "qmi ioremap error for BDF\n");
ret = -EIO;
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.h b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.h
index 3f7db642d869..a7a0a189cbe4 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.h
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/ath/ath11k/qmi.h
@@ -12,7 +12,6 @@
#define ATH11K_HOST_VERSION_STRING "WIN"
#define ATH11K_QMI_WLANFW_TIMEOUT_MS 5000
#define ATH11K_QMI_MAX_BDF_FILE_NAME_SIZE 64
-#define ATH11K_QMI_BDF_ADDRESS 0x4B0C0000
#define ATH11K_QMI_BDF_MAX_SIZE (256 * 1024)
#define ATH11K_QMI_CALDATA_OFFSET (128 * 1024)
#define ATH11K_QMI_WLANFW_MAX_BUILD_ID_LEN_V01 128
